Understanding the Mechanics of Kalshi Trading
At the core of kalshi's functionality lies the concept of contracts. Each contract represents a specific question with a binary or multi-outcome resolution. For example, a contract might ask “Will the US Federal Reserve raise interest rates by December 31st, 2024?” Traders can then buy “yes” contracts, betting that the event will occur, or “no” contracts, betting that it will not. The price of each contract fluctuates based on supply and demand, reflecting the collective beliefs of the traders. As more people believe an event is likely to happen, the price of “yes” contracts increases, and vice versa. This dynamic pricing mechanism is what allows kalshi to act as an information aggregator, revealing the market’s consensus view on the probability of an event occurring.
The key to successful trading on kalshi, as with any financial market, is understanding the interplay between probability, price, and risk. Traders need to assess the likelihood of an event occurring and compare that assessment to the current market price of the associated contract. If a trader believes the market is underestimating the probability of an event, they would buy “yes” contracts, hoping to profit when the price rises as more people come to the same conclusion. Conversely, if they believe the market is overestimating the probability of an event, they would buy “no” contracts. Furthermore, understanding position sizing and risk management is crucial to protect against potential losses. Effective traders don’t simply rely on gut feelings but rather conduct thorough research, analyze relevant data, and develop a well-defined trading strategy.
The Role of Liquidity and Market Depth
The efficiency of a market is heavily influenced by its liquidity and depth. Liquidity refers to the ease with which contracts can be bought and sold without significantly impacting the price. Higher liquidity generally translates to lower transaction costs and tighter spreads between the buying and selling prices. Market depth, on the other hand, refers to the volume of outstanding orders at different price levels. Greater depth implies that large trades can be executed without causing substantial price swings. kalshi, as a relatively new platform, is continually working to enhance its liquidity and depth by attracting more traders and introducing new contracts. Increased participation and a wider selection of events will contribute to a more robust and informative trading environment, ultimately benefiting all users.

Kalshi and Strategic Foresight
Beyond the potential for financial gain, kalshi offers a powerful tool for strategic foresight. By analyzing the prices of contracts, businesses and organizations can gain valuable insights into market expectations regarding future events that could impact their operations. For instance, a company considering launching a new product could monitor contracts related to the success of similar products in the market. Similarly, a government agency responsible for disaster preparedness could track contracts related to the likelihood of natural disasters in specific regions. The collective wisdom of the market, as reflected in the contract prices, can provide a more accurate and nuanced assessment of future risks and opportunities than traditional forecasting methods.
This real-time intelligence can be used to inform decision-making, mitigate risks, and allocate resources more effectively. Instead of relying on subjective opinions or outdated data, organizations can leverage the objectivity and predictive power of kalshi's markets. This proactive approach to risk management can provide a significant competitive advantage in today’s rapidly changing world. The ability to adapt quickly to emerging trends and anticipate potential disruptions is crucial for long-term success, and kalshi offers a valuable resource for organizations seeking to enhance their strategic capabilities.

The Regulatory Landscape and Future Prospects
As a regulated entity, kalshi operates within a complex and evolving regulatory landscape. The CFTC’s oversight ensures a level of consumer protection and market integrity that is often absent in unregulated prediction markets. However, the regulatory framework also presents challenges, particularly in terms of compliance costs and restrictions on the types of events that can be traded. kalshi is actively working with regulators to expand the scope of permissible contracts and to streamline the regulatory process. This ongoing dialogue is crucial to fostering innovation and growth within the predictive market industry.

The Impact on Information Efficiency
Predictive markets, like those facilitated by kalshi, have been shown to improve information efficiency in various contexts. The aggregation of diverse opinions and knowledge through market trading can lead to more accurate forecasts than those generated by experts or traditional polling methods. This is because markets incentivize participants to reveal their true beliefs and to incorporate new information quickly. The price of a contract effectively represents the collective intelligence of the market, providing a real-time assessment of the probability of an event occurring. This information can be valuable for a wide range of stakeholders, including policymakers, investors, and researchers.
Moreover, the incentive structure of kalshi encourages participants to actively seek out and analyze relevant information, as their profitability depends on the accuracy of their predictions. This leads to a more informed and efficient market, where prices reflect the latest available information. The platform’s transparency also contributes to information efficiency, as all trades are publicly visible (though individual identities are protected). This allows market participants to observe trading patterns and to draw their own conclusions about the underlying events. This contrasts with opaque systems where information is restricted and manipulation is more easily concealed.

Beyond Prediction: Scenario Analysis and Contingency Planning
While initially designed for prediction, the data generated by kalshi markets provides a robust foundation for scenario analysis and contingency planning. By observing how market prices react to different pieces of information, analysts can identify key variables that are driving expectations about future events. This understanding can then be used to develop more realistic and comprehensive scenario plans. For example, a company preparing for a potential supply chain disruption could monitor contracts related to geopolitical risks and commodity prices to assess the likelihood and potential impact of different disruption scenarios.
The ability to quantify the probabilities of different outcomes is also invaluable for developing effective contingency plans. Instead of simply preparing for the most likely scenario, organizations can develop plans for a range of potential outcomes, weighted by their respective probabilities. This allows them to allocate resources more efficiently and to be better prepared for unexpected events. The dynamics of kalshi markets emphasize the shifting probabilities, meaning contingency plans are not static; they should be dynamic and responsive to changing market signals. This iterative approach to risk management can significantly enhance an organization’s resilience in the face of uncertainty.
